Standard Fleet
Seed Round in 2023
Standard Fleet develops electric fleet management software, specializing in Tesla and internet-connected EVs, designed for delivery, rental, carsharing, lease, and taxi fleets. The platform provides online and mobile tools to monitor battery charge and health, manage charging, track trips and expenses, and generate activity, mileage, and maintenance alerts. It enables operators including rental, dealership, government, and service fleets to manage, monitor, and scale electric vehicle operations efficiently without hardware installation. The company's solutions integrate dashboard applications and APIs to automate workflows, secure vehicles, and provide insights and controls that save time and money. The team comprises engineers and professionals with experience from major tech and mobility firms, focused on delivering scalable software that supports EV fleet operations.
Raise Commercial Real Estate
Seed Round in 2019
Raise Commercial Real Estate, formerly known as HelloOffice, Inc., is a commercial real estate brokerage firm based in San Francisco, California, with additional offices in Los Angeles and Silicon Valley. Established in 2015, the company specializes in assisting startups and high-growth companies in finding suitable office spaces. Raise Commercial Real Estate offers a comprehensive range of services, including planning (financial analysis, legal, zoning, and site selection), buildout (workplace strategy, project management, and architecture), and operations (move coordination, furniture, office management, and lease administration). The company also provides document management and commute analysis services. By combining experienced brokers with user-friendly software, Raise Commercial Real Estate aims to streamline the process of securing commercial real estate for its clients.
Uppercase
Seed Round in 2018
Uppercase is a retail solutions company founded in 2016 and based in New York, New York. It specializes in helping brands establish and enhance their retail presence through a comprehensive suite of services. Uppercase provides a marketplace for short-term retail space and offers tech-enabled stores, allowing brands to launch, measure, and improve their operations in key markets such as New York City, Los Angeles, Toronto, and Vancouver. The company integrates various aspects of the retail process, including real estate, store build-outs, analytics, and staffing, to create a seamless experience for brands. By leveraging data-driven insights, Uppercase enables businesses to efficiently navigate their retail journey and achieve success in a competitive landscape.
WanderJaunt
Seed Round in 2017
WanderJaunt, Inc. is a property management company based in San Francisco, California, that specializes in managing vacation rentals for homeowners and guests. Founded in 2016, WanderJaunt offers technology-enabled solutions that facilitate seamless experiences for travelers. The company negotiates lease agreements with property owners or employs a commission model, retaining a portion of rental income. Its platform provides guests with convenient accommodations that include various amenities such as cookware, dinnerware, cable TV, and essential toiletries, ensuring a comfortable stay while allowing them to explore new communities.

42Floors
Seed Round in 2011
42Floors Inc. is a company that specializes in commercial real estate services, primarily focusing on office space. Established in 2011 and headquartered in San Francisco, California, the company operates a web platform that aggregates listings from various sources, including brokerages, landlords, and Craigslist, across 200 cities in the United States. This platform facilitates the search for office properties, as well as leasing services for various types of spaces, including retail, industrial, medical, and restaurants. 42Floors aims to simplify the process for tenants, brokers, and landlords, enabling them to find suitable office spaces tailored to their needs. The company operates as a subsidiary of Knotel, Inc.
Zeus Living
Seed Round in 2011
Zeus Living, Inc. is a property management company based in San Francisco, California, founded in 2015. It specializes in renting furnished housing to startups, students, and businesses across several key markets, including the Bay Area, Seattle, Los Angeles, and the District of Columbia. Zeus Living partners with homeowners to furnish and manage their properties, thereby providing attractive rental options for corporate clients and facilitating a higher rental income for property owners. Additionally, the company offers a web-based application that delivers property information, enhancing the user experience for both tenants and homeowners.
Getable
Seed Round in 2011
Getable, Inc. is an online equipment rental service based in San Francisco, California, established in 2009. The company allows consumers to easily search, compare, and rent a variety of products, including electronics, appliances, fashion wear, furniture, event supplies, sports gear, tools, vehicles, and more. Getable acts as a rental concierge, facilitating access to equipment from trusted local suppliers, ensuring transparent pricing with no hidden fees. Customers can place orders through the company's mobile app, by phone, or via text, making the rental process convenient and efficient.
